Enhancing Safety


The primary function of stainless steel rope helipad perimeter safety netting is to prevent accidental falls and unauthorized access to the helipad area. As helicopters are often utilized for emergency services, news media, and corporate travel, a secure environment is essential for the safety of passengers, crew, and ground personnel. The netting acts as a deterrent, keeping individuals at a safe distance from the operational area while still allowing visibility.


Durable Material


Stainless steel is renowned for its strength and durability, making it an ideal choice for outdoor applications such as helipad safety netting. Unlike traditional materials, stainless steel does not corrode, rust, or weaken over time. This long-lasting quality ensures a reliable safety solution that can withstand harsh weather conditions, sun exposure, and the wear and tear of daily operations. Furthermore, the aesthetic appeal of stainless steel adds a professional look to helipads, enhancing the overall environment.

One of the significant advantages of stainless steel rope netting is its low maintenance requirements. The inherent properties of stainless steel allow it to retain its structural integrity with minimal upkeep. Periodic inspections are recommended to ensure that the netting remains secure and effective; however, the need for frequent replacements or repairs is drastically reduced. As a result, this cost-effective solution provides long-term protection without the burden of constant maintenance efforts.


Versatility of Design


The versatility of stainless steel rope safety netting allows it to be customized according to specific helipad dimensions and safety requirements. It can be designed in various mesh sizes and configurations to suit different operational needs. Additionally, the netting can be crafted to ensure that it blends seamlessly with the existing infrastructure while maintaining a high level of safety. This customization is crucial for helipads located in diverse environments—from urban settings with high-rise buildings to remote areas with natural landscapes.
